What Is IVR Recording?

IVR stands for Interactive Voice Response. It’s the automated system you hear when you call a company and get options like “Press 1 for Sales, Press 2 for Support.” IVR recording services help businesses create these voice prompts and menus with clear, friendly, and professional recordings.

Why IVR Matters for Your Business

Saves Time for Customers and Staff

No one enjoys waiting on hold or getting transferred multiple times. A well-designed IVR system lets customers self-serve by choosing the right department or information, reducing wait times and freeing up your staff for more complex tasks.

Enhances Customer Experience

Good IVR recordings make your business sound professional and organized. Friendly voice prompts help callers feel comfortable and confident that their call will be handled properly.

Improves Call Routing Accuracy

By guiding callers to the right destination from the start, IVR systems reduce the chances of calls being sent to the wrong department or employee. This means faster resolution and happier customers.

Provides 24/7 Support Options

IVR can offer recorded information or options even when your team is offline. This means customers can still get answers or leave messages outside business hours.

How IVR Recording Services Work

You start by planning your call flow: what options callers should hear and what actions they can take. Then, with IVR recording services, professional voice artists record clear messages that match your brand’s tone. These recordings get uploaded into your phone system or cloud PBX.

Many services also allow you to update recordings easily when your business changes.

Tips for Great IVR Recordings

  • Keep messages short and simple.
  • Use a warm, clear voice.
  • Avoid too many menu options.
  • Regularly update recordings to reflect current services.
